2nd BIO-ICT Summer School started at the Institute for Marine Biology in Kotor on 28 August and it will last until 2 September 2017.  

BIO-ICT Centre of Excellence organises the Summer School for University of Montenegro students in order to present them the latest trends in the field of information technologies, usage of IT in daily life, cutting-edge IoT developments.

Students from the Faculty of Electrical Engineering, Biotechnical Faculty, Faculty of Science and Mathematics, Faculty of Medicine and Faculty of Political Science will have the opportunity to learn more about the application of bioinformatics in ecology and agriculture through practical work with researchers. The main goal of the BIO-ICT Summer School is to promote multidisciplinary team work of students from different fields where they will be informed about the up-to-date developments in the field of bioinformatics, as well as BIO-ICT Centre key activities.

BIO-ICT Summer School offers a five-day programme where participants will get acquainted with the Institute of Marine Biology work and marine biology basics, and they will also visit COGIMAR and their shellfish and fish farms to be introduced to the integral mariculture.  In addition to the methodology of laboratory work where they will learn about the work of biosensors on shells, students will take part in the field work at sea where they will be sampling sea water on the research boat. BIO-ICT Centre researchers will present to the students the greatest BIO-ICT achievements and current activities, such as: presentation of the smart buoy, IoT concept and cloud computing, wireless communication systems of the fifth generation and possible solutions for antenna systems, analysis of satellite monitoring of Chlorophylla a, as well as chemical, biological and microbiological analysis and drifter operations and sea current measurements activities. One day of the Summer School will be dedicated to an interactive workshop where students will participate in practical experiments with BIO-ICT researchers, and present the results of their work. Students of the Summer School will also be the first participants of the MOOC (massive on-line open course), prepared within the BIO-ICT Centre of Excellence, which is also the first course of this type at the University of Montenegro.
